btrfs: avoid monopolizing a core when activating a swap file
commit 2c8507c63f upstream.
During swap activation we iterate over the extents of a file and we can
have many thousands of them, so we can end up in a busy loop monopolizing
a core. Avoid this by doing a voluntary reschedule after processing each
extent.
